I was proud to support the passage of the Marijuana Regulation & Taxation Act (MRTA), and bring this shadow economy into the light. Beyond the economic benefits, this was an overdue course-corrective on New York’s discriminatory war on drugs. As we work to get the legal market for recreational marijuana up and running this year, I will work to ensure the licensing process is equitable, and that Black and brown communities that have been over-policed have the resources to succeed in this industry.

Legal marijuana is a burgeoning industry, and I will do everything in my power to remove barriers to entering this market.
